How they compare
Macao currently reports 733 against 694 in Barbados, a difference of 39.
That makes Macao's figure about 1.1 times Barbados's.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Macao ahead.
Barbados ranks 138th and Macao ranks 137th of 180 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Barbados averaged higher in 1 and Macao in 2.
